I just finished the game and I thought it was a great game. It wasn't a short game, either. If you play straight through, I didn't, be prepared to spend at least 4 hrs playing. It's a great storyline that delves into Native American lore and it keeps you engrossed to the point to where you almost feel part of the investigation and not playing a game. They make good use of the tools that many paranormal teams use in their investigations (I am an investigator). My only issue is the thermal camera. The contrast is realistic but at times you have to guess where some things go since the darker areas look alike. The HO scenes are well done and the puzzles, while not too difficult aren't so difficult that you just wait for the skip button to charge. Over all it's very well made game that I enjoyed immensely.
